Costs and Fees of Registered Agents
When considering the services of registered agents, understanding the costs involved is crucial for effective budget management. The charges can vary significantly based on the provider, the type of service you require, and your business's unique requirements. On average, businesses can expect to pay anywhere from $100 to $300 each year for the services of registered agents. This cost often encompasses essential functions such as receiving service of process, maintaining a registered office, and ensuring compliance with state laws.
Extra fees may arise based on the services included in your chosen plan. For instance, some registered agent firms offer additional services such as document management, annual compliance filings, and business address services, which can increase the overall price. It's advisable to thoroughly examine the service agreement to be aware of these potential fees and evaluate what services are essential for your business operations.

Common Misconceptions about Registered Agents
One of the primary myths about registered agents is that they are exclusively responsible for receiving official documents. While it is true that an agent for service of process handles significant notices and legal correspondence, their role extends beyond just mail handling. Registered agents also ensure that businesses remain compliant with state requirements, provide critical reminders for annual reports and filings, and assist with company representation during various legal and administrative processes.
A further misconception is that registered agents are only necessary for big corporations or businesses. In reality, every LLC or corporation, regardless of its magnitude, is required to designate a registered agent to maintain its good standing. This means emerging companies, small businesses, and foreign entities operating within a state all benefit from having a reliable registered agent. Failing to do so can lead to compliance issues, which may result in sanctions or problems in maintaining the business’s legal status.
